Output b2378268fff7aef6d24f59ba44308a7ef5dd8bbd58158c77fd6f56f58c6ee8ed:2

value
134568814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d3187a578248a693fdcbbb59a787d2cbf884cc9 OP_EQUAL
address
34MNrW6TVqmeQePfELjr1UoHH1hse8AmEq
transaction
b2378268fff7aef6d24f59ba44308a7ef5dd8bbd58158c77fd6f56f58c6ee8ed
spent
true